Transaction d4dbd64f123fe500f3c507500a49a4c002bd551039bbb2663152212f34eb67b1

31 Input
2 Outputs
  • d4dbd64f123fe500f3c507500a49a4c002bd551039bbb2663152212f34eb67b1:0
  • value  1683707
    address  3M6Jpd6kMx3h3Hy2oTRJJWEGje3p9ZzqUk
  • d4dbd64f123fe500f3c507500a49a4c002bd551039bbb2663152212f34eb67b1:1
  • value  160806728
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s